Emphasize Education and Discipline like in China: In China, education is highly valued, and parents place a strong emphasis on academic success. One of the key parenting tips from China is the importance of instilling a sense of discipline and hard work in children from a young age. Chinese parents often set high expectations for their children and provide support and guidance to help them excel in school. To apply this parenting tip to your own life, consider creating a structured routine for your child that includes dedicated study time and clear academic goals. Encourage perseverance and resilience in the face of challenges, and celebrate achievements to motivate your child to strive for excellence. 2. Prioritize Outdoor Time and Nature Connection like in Slovenia: Slovenia, with its stunning natural landscapes, places a strong emphasis on outdoor activities and connecting with nature. Slovenian parents often encourage their children to spend time outdoors, exploring the beauty of the natural world and engaging in physical activities. To incorporate this parenting tip into your routine, make an effort to plan outdoor adventures with your child, such as hiking, biking, or gardening. Spending time in nature can help children develop a sense of wonder and appreciation for the environment, while also promoting physical health and well-being. 3. Foster Independence and Critical Thinking: Both Chinese and Slovenian parenting styles emphasize the importance of fostering independence and critical thinking in children. In China, parents encourage self-reliance and problem-solving skills, while Slovenian parents value creativity and independent thought. To promote independence in your child, encourage them to take on age-appropriate responsibilities and make decisions for themselves. Provide opportunities for creative expression and allow your child to explore their interests and passions. By nurturing independence and critical thinking skills, you can empower your child to navigate the complexities of the world with confidence and resilience.
